Lighting training

We attended a lighting training session in college in case we had any studio scenes and wanted to have the perfect lighting. We were taught various techniques and key lighting elements that would effect our footage.




Firstly we were taught about key lighting. The key light is the first and usually most important light that is used in a lighting set up. The purpose of this is to highlight the form and dimension of the subject (in this case Me, shown above). No matter what, key light is needed in any studio shot unless you are looking for a sillhouette which is caused if key light is not used.




The key light can be focused (hard) or diffused (soft) depending on the desired effect and can be placed at any angle relative to the subject. The most common set up in lighting is the three point lighting.




The three point lighting includes the key light, fill light and back light. The fill light is used to balance out the contrast of a scene and provide some illumination for the areas of the image that are in shadow. The fill light is often softer and, by definition, less intense than the key light. a fill light that is a small fraction of the power of the key light will produce very high-contrast or low-key lighting, while filling with half or more of the key light power will produce a high key, low-contrast tone.



Finally we learnt about back light the final part of the three point light. Back lighting refers to the process of illuminating the subject from the back. In other words, the lighting instrument and the viewer are facing towards each other, with the subject in between. This causes the edges of the subject to glow, while the other areas remain darker.

Day 1 of filming!!

Finally it was time to start filming we had our hearts set out to film at Crystal Palace Park as it had that rustic feel that we needed for our music video. It had been predicted that it would be a good and warm day which was perfect for filming.
I and Duane had ideas that we could incorporate in this scene. The aim of the scene was to have both protagonists in the park which shows a connection between both of them, in separate areas f the park they would bout have different positions but both reflect the same body language of heartbreak and regret.


First shot was of Duane sitting on the old step in the park singing the first verse if the song whilst filming we had noticed that it was a bit bland and decided to start of with an out of focus shot in the introduction of the song just to give that realistic effect. We had done this shot as a close up just so we could have a clear identification of his facial expressions. This shot was done numerous times as we wanted to have a choice of which one we were going to edit.




We had also done some shots where Duane was walking around the park we decided to shoot this in different angles to get different perspectives of his character as if we were on a journey with him. These shots included;

  • Close ups
  • Medium shots
  • Long shots
  • Point of view shots
  • Over the shoulder shots
  • Panning shots
  • And of course following the 180 degrees rule

Our aim of his scene was to also get different shots from other locations in order for us to mix and match shots to create a collage of shots all to represent the same theme.



The next scene that we had done was my scene we weren’t going to shoot much of it as we wanted to change locations and time was against us. So we both decided to do a short walking sequence to start of my verse, things didn’t exactly go to plan as England’s weather proved unpredictable and it started to rain on us, as we were cold and wet we thought we should quickly shoot this scene and get it as precise as possible in order to finish quicker. We stuck with a medium shot and me walking towards the camera with a pan as I past it.

All in all I would say that this was a good start of our filming despite the weather and there was nothing that we would want to change as we had captured the effect that we had originally planned.

Music Video Analysis


1. Jay Z- On to the next one


The video that I have chosen to analyse is Jay z-on to the next one the reason why I have chosen this video is that even though it has some features that average hip-hop music videos have e.g. the studio and the black and white theme, this one is slightly more unique as other hip-hop videos have a few scene of clubs and bar filled with women or a studio full of half naked dancing women but this video only have one female decently dressed dancing on a pile of designer suitcases representing wealth. This video is only based on montage shots where there are a total of 38 montage shots altogether during the 4.16min song. The theme of the video n is quite dark and evil which is shown in the montage shots and the theme of black with hints of white (greyscale). When it comes to variety of shot there pretty much is none just a few panning shots but the rest are between medium shots and close ups which mainly focus on the artist (Jay Z) which is kind of weird as new artists usually do that just so the viewer remembers their face but as Jay Z is a world famous it is as if he is rubbing it in the views face. Back to the video it is more a performance/ concept based as the is no set story to the song or the video even though there are no instruments shown this is still classified as a performance based video.

When going further into detail about the video there is no option but to look at the montage shots which dominated the entire video the montage shots are used as visual representation for the lyrics this could be used to help the viewer remember the lyrics of his song not only that but the use of on beat cutting helps the viewer remember the beat of the song which is added to the montage shots so altogether the viewer instantly knows the song and would recognise it where ever they go. Also as the montage shots are of particularly weird things which follows up the overall theme of the video it has that eye catching effect which keeps the viewer focused on the video.
